Austin Butler is WWII Bomber in Steven Spielberg's 'Masters of the Air' teaser
Image
Actor Austin Butler is taking flight in his new role ‘Masters of the Air’. According to the show’s official synopsis, the historical drama follows the “men of the 100th Bomb Group”, also known as the “Bloody Hundredth” as they perform “perilous bombing raids” over Nazi Germany during World War II.

The men face terrible conditions, including frigid temperatures and lack of oxygen, while experiencing the horrors of war, reports ‘People’ magazine.

The Steven Spielberg and Tom Hanks-led series portrays the “psychological and emotional price paid by these young men as they helped destroy the horror of Hitler’s Third Reich”.

Shot in locations ranging from the idyllic rolling hills of southeast England to the “harsh deprivations of a German Prisoner of War Camp”, many soldiers were shot down, captured, wounded, and “some were lucky enough to make it home”.

The teaser begins with sounds of distant gunfire and bombs going off.
